AllTheCakes · 12/03/2019 13:57

Good luck OP!

I was induced with the drip and had an epidural with it. I really didn’t want the epidural but after speaking to the midwives I went with it and I am so glad I did! Apparently not many women labour on the drip without the epidural. I had a very relaxed labour on it which was relatively pain free. If you do decide to go for it, I would ask before you go on the drip as the contractions come on quickly and the process can take a while. Wishing you all the best.

AllTheCakes · 12/03/2019 14:48

I had the pessary twice and they managed to break my waters after 48hrs of the pessary being in. My contractions never came on naturally so I started the drip a few hours after my waters broke. If it is looking likely that you will be going on the drip, remember you can’t eat or drink whilst on it so make sure you stock up on some food beforehand!
